titleOfInvention | An environmentally friendly thermal insulation material with flame retardant properties |
abstract | The invention discloses an environmentally friendly heat preservation material with flame retardancy, which comprises the following components: sodium carboxymethyl cellulose; aluminate compounds; polyacrylate emulsion; phenolic resin regenerated material; phosphorus-containing epoxy resin; fiber; rice husk powder; acetic anhydride; calcium stearate; water reducer; deionized water. The invention provides an environmentally friendly thermal insulation material with flame retardancy, which not only has flame retardancy and UV protection, but also effectively improves the thermal insulation performance of the environmentally friendly thermal insulation material, and improves its flexural strength, water resistance and adaptability. |
